Learning outcomes of the course unit

Students learn about the structure of itemized budget and its further division into basic and minor itemized budget. Students have understanding of the calculation formula and therefore are able to calculate new items. Students are capable of processing a budget according to basic budget rules. The student learns the skill to work with BUILpower software designed for budget calculations. Other skills acquired are the principles of network analysis, the ability to create a network graph and calculate the critical path. The acquired complex skill allows the student to create a construction technology model of the building process, the use of many different links concerning the modelling of the building process. Students learn how to work with CONTEC software.

Assesment methods and criteria linked to learning outcomes

The main criterion for credit is active participation during the seminars, i.e. no more than two absences during the course, and all the tasks assigned individually must be properly fulfilled. Students must submit an itemized budget of a given technological phase in the building process and a time plan reflected as a network graph using computer tools.
